Default external spare tire?

I have a 94 s10 Blazer. It didnt come with the spare tire carrier on the tailgate.

I would like to install one. Were all of the bodies capable of accepting this option or do I actually need to do some fab work to that corner (inside) to mount one?

I just want to get the spare tire out of the back, it takes up too much room. I figure I could probably get one of these spare tire carriers at the junk yard and recondition it easy enough.
